Etymology
[
edit
]
Contraction of
やんか
(
yanka
)
, itself from
やないか
(
yanaika
)
.
Verb
[
edit
]
やん
•
(
yan
)
(
informal
,
Kansai
dialect
)
isn't it?
right
?
一日中
勉強
する
と
ゆった
のに、
遊んどる
だけ
やん
。
Even though you said you were going to study all day, you're just playing around,
huh
?
